Funds Enterprise
The Carlson Funds Enterprise (CFE) was one of the first student-managed portfolios in the country. Our students and professional advisors are responsible for a small capitalization growth fund and a fixed income fund that combine for an asset total of approximately $35 million. That figure puts CFE in the top three student-managed investment funds in the world, based on assets under management. The students who make up the CFE work with real participants who have invested real money on which they expect a real return. Our students are required to practice real world management.
- Presenting well-researched investment proposals to the CFE investment board
- Interviewing management of potential investment opportunities to complete due diligence
- Producing monthly participant performance and accounting reports
- Analyzing investment opportunities by establishing intrinsic long-term value
Our Funds
The CFE manages two distinct funds, a small capitalization growth fund and a fixed income fund. CFE students manage all aspects of the funds including analysis of securities, trading, compliance, marketing, and client reporting. Students are guided by two investment industry professionals.
The Carlson School Growth Fund currently has approximately $18 million under management. Analysts research and present new stock ideas to the Investment Oversight Committee twice per year. Assistance and oversight is provided by professional mentors and academic faculty.
The Carlson School Fixed Income Fund currently has approximately $17 million under management. Each analyst covers a sector, with new research presented to the Investment Oversight Committee twice a year. Assistance and oversight is provided by professional mentors and academic faculty.
